BLOG

Insights and Expertise from Stepmedia

Stay informed on the latest technology trends, software development best practices, and industry insights.

Latest articles

Most viewed

Technology

10 Type of Web Application 2025: Which To Choose

10 Types of web applications 2025 : Static web applications, Dynamic web applications, Single-page web applications (SPA),  Multi-page web applications (MPA), Content management systems (CMS), E-commerce web applications, Animated web applications, Portal web applications, Rich Internet Applications (RIA), Progressive Web Applications (PWA)

Technology

Commercial Off-the-Shelf (COTS) Software | Definition, Benefit, Drawbacks

Commercial Off-the-Shelf (COTS) software offers businesses readily available and often cost-effective solutions, but careful consideration of its limitations and thorough validation are essential for successful implementation.

Technology

What is Computer-aided Software Engineering (CASE)? | 10 Type of CASE

Computer-aided software engineering is a set of tools that automate and support every stage of the software development process, helping teams work faster and smarter. It improves productivity, software quality, and project management through structured workflows and automation.

Technology

Master Domain Specific Languages: The Secret to Efficiency

Domain-specific language is a specialized programming language designed for specific tasks, like SQL for databases. Unlike general-purpose programming languages, it improves code optimization and productivity by simplifying software development in targeted domains.

Software Development

V-Model in Software Development: Process, Advantages, and Best Practices

The V-Model is a sequential SDLC methodology that emphasizes parallel verification and validation, ensuring quality through structured testing. While optimal for projects with stable requirements and strict compliance, its rigid structure presents challenges in dynamic environments requiring iterative adaptation.

Technology

What Is Elixir? The Secret Behind Scalable Web Solutions!

This article explores what is Elixir? Covering its features, benefits, and real-world applications. We’ll also look at popular Elixir frameworks like Phoenix framework and Nerves framework, which help developers build high-performance software. Whether you’re a developer or a business leader, understanding Elixir’s advantages can help you decide if it’s the...

Software Development

10 Pros and Cons of Open-Source Software for Businesses

Open-source software provides cost savings, customization options, and community support. However, it may have limited professional assistance and face integration challenges. Businesses should carefully consider the advantages and disadvantages to determine if it is the right choice.

UI/UX Design

How Much Does It Cost to Design an App in 2025? Update new

The cost of designing an app varies based on platform guidelines, design complexity, and required features. While simple apps cost a few thousand dollars, high-end applications with custom animations and interactive elements can exceed $100,000.

Technology

Top 100 Software Development Frameworks in 2025

Top software development frameworks in 2025: React.js (Facebook), Angular (Google), Vue.js, Remix (Shopify), Apache Sling (Java Web Framework), Svelte, React Native, Flutter, SwiftUI, Kotlin Multiplatform, Xamarin, Django (Python), Flask (Python), Express.js (Node.js), Laravel (PHP), and more.